What Is a Naturally Fermented Pickle?
Naturally fermented pickles, widely celebrated as crisp, tangy cucumbers preserved through lacto-fermentation, are produced by submerging fresh cucumbers in a saltwater brine without vinegar. It is a preservation method practiced globally for millennia. Consequently, this beloved food has served traditional European, Asian, and Middle Eastern culinary and healing systems. How to Add Fermented Pickles to Your Diet
The therapeutic probiotic food is versatile, functioning as a crisp, tangy culinary addition to diverse everyday dishes:
-
Served alongside sandwiches: Place crisp fermented pickle spears next to grain bowls, wraps, or sandwiches for a sharp, savory crunch.
-
Chop into potato or grain salads: Dice naturally fermented pickles to add deep umami and probiotic tang to homemade salads.
-
Sip small amounts of brine: Drink a small splash of the probiotic-rich pickle juice as a quick post-workout electrolyte boost.
-
Verify fermentation method: Ensure your pickles are explicitly labeled “naturally fermented” or “lacto-fermented” in the refrigerated section, as standard shelf-stable pickles use vinegar and pasteurization that destroys live cultures.
Safety Considerations for Fermented Pickles
The nutrient-dense food is remarkably safe for most individuals. However, specific physiological factors require attention:
-
Sodium Content Awareness: Because natural fermentation requires a salt brine, individuals managing strict blood pressure restrictions or chronic kidney conditions should monitor portion sizes carefully.
-
Gastric Acidity Sensitivity: Because these pickles are rich in organic acids and salt, consuming excessive quantities at once may cause mild acid reflux or oral sensitivity in sensitive individuals.
-
Refrigeration Requirements: Always keep naturally fermented pickles refrigerated to slow further fermentation and preserve their live probiotic populations.
-
Sourcing and Quality: Avoid pasteurized shelf-stable pickles if you seek live probiotics, as heat processing eliminates the beneficial bacteria.
